OBJECTIVE: To investigate whether PALSA PLUS, an on-site educational outreach programme of non-didactic, case based, iterative clinical education of staff, led by a trainer, can increase access to and comprehensiveness of care for patients with HIV/AIDS.Entities:

Trial outcomes in intervention clinics (with added PALSA PLUS outreach education) and control clinics (with specialist ART nurse training only)
| No (%, SD, or IQR) | OR, HR, MD, or IRR* (95% CI) | P value | Intracluster correlation coefficient |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Intervention clinics | Control clinics | ||||
| Enrolment in programme through new HIV testing (1 year)† | 3048/5793 (53%) | 2187/4343 (50%) | OR 1.19 (0.51 to 2.77) | 0.695 | 0.108 |
| Provision of co-trimoxazole prophylaxis over 12 months | 2253/5523 (41%) | 1340/4210 (32%) | OR 1.95 (1.11 to 3.40) | 0.020 | 0.034 |
| Tuberculosis case detection† | 417/5793 (7%) | 245/4343 (6%) | OR 1.25 (1.01 to 1.55) | 0.038 | 0.027 |
| Viral load suppressed after 6 months’ antiretroviral treatment | 332/389 (85%) | 332/389 (88%) | OR 0.96 (0.74 to 1.26) | 0.779 | 0.088 |
| Mortality | 958/4754 (20%) | 792/3645 (22%) | HR 0.90 (0.67 to 1.19) | 0.466 | NA |
| CD4 follow-up among patients with initial CD4 200-500 cells/μl | 1127/1276 (88%) | 954/1141 (84%) | OR 1.39 (0.65 to 2.96) | 0.40 | 0.022 |
| Weight gain (kg) | 2.3 (SD 5.8) | 1.9 (SD 6.1) | MD 0.55 (0.30 to 0.79) | <0.001 | 0.10 |
| Clinic visits | 6 (IQR 3-15) | 8 (IQR 4-19) | IRR 0.95 (0.77 to 1.18) | 0.658 | 0.026 |
| Enrolment in programme through new HIV testing (1 month) * | 357/653 (55%) | 214/499 (43%) | OR 1.58 (1.01 to 2.48) | 0.054 | 0.113 |
| Provision of co-trimoxazole prophylaxis to patients with ≤200 CD4 cells/μl, AIDS, or tuberculosis | 1762/2419 (73%) | 1025/1572 (65%) | OR 1.88 (1.07 to 3.31) | 0.029 | 0.035 |
IQR=interquartile range.
*OR=odds ratio; HR=hazard ratio; MD=mean difference; IRR=incidence rate ratio.
†Denominator includes all patients enrolled in treatment programme, as well as patients who were tested through programme with negative results.
